Forums / Unable to Access & Use Old Domain URL after Domain Transfer

Unable to Access & Use Old Domain URL after Domain Transfer

    Hi,

    I recently transferred my domain from WordPress.com to another domain registrar as per the instructions for domain transfer provided by WordPress.com here.

    After the waiting period of transfer, the domain was able to transfer over to the new registrar.

    However, to my disappointment and surprise, none of my site visitors can access, much less visit, its original domain URL at — https://jacwyn.com. This is even after updating the DNS records at the new registrar for the transferred domain.

    When visiting the URL, it simply shows an error page stating that the browser cannot reach the site and establish a connection to it.

    I followed all the steps provided in the instructions to a T but have still not been able to resolve this problem for days and find what to do exactly to fix this.

    If anyone can provide help or guide me in the right direction, that would be much appreciated.

    Note: I have also tried to reach WordPress Support as a business plan customer here but have not received any word since the initial request for help which was made more than 5 days ago…

    Thanks in advance for any assistance and help from the community if anyone can.

    Hi,

    I’m sorry to hear that you’re experiencing issues accessing your site after transferring your domain. I’d be happy to help you resolve this.

    When you transfer a domain to a new registrar, the DNS settings often reset to default. This means you’ll need to update your DNS records at your new registrar to point to your website’s hosting provider. Here are some steps you can follow:

    1. Update Your DNS Settings:
      • Log in to your account at your new domain registrar.
      • Navigate to the DNS management section for your domain.
      • If your website is still hosted on WordPress.com, you’ll need to point your domain to WordPress.com’s servers by setting the following name servers:
        • ns1.wordpress.com
        • ns2.wordpress.com
        • ns3.wordpress.com
      • If your website is hosted elsewhere, update the DNS records to point to your new hosting provider’s servers. They should provide you with the necessary DNS information.
    2. Check for DNS Propagation:
      • After updating the DNS settings, it can take up to 48 hours for the changes to propagate worldwide, though it usually happens sooner.
      • You can use tools like WhatsMyDNS.net to check the propagation status.
    3. Verify Website Hosting:
      • Ensure that your website’s files are hosted and active on the server you’re pointing to.
      • If your site is still on WordPress.com, make sure your WordPress.com site is still published and not set to private.
    4. Clear Your Browser Cache:
      • Sometimes, cached data can cause loading issues. Try clearing your browser cache or accessing your site from a different browser or device.
